Transaction 95601ce49a972a1b13ea603c16bf2b82f76b2e421d7ca6fc8adfd3fcc70c949b

1 Input
1 Outputs
  • 95601ce49a972a1b13ea603c16bf2b82f76b2e421d7ca6fc8adfd3fcc70c949b:0
  • value  152356
    address  1LX4rydCerEDhC6zARs8HphdptkjRiWY5A